Internet TCP port 995 is primarily used by email protocols that require encryption for secure data transmission. For instance, the Post Office Protocol 3 (POP3) uses this port to retrieve email from a remote server over a SSL/TLS connection. This ensures that sensitive information, such as login credentials and email content, is encrypted and secure from potential eavesdropping. Examples of software that use this port include email clients like Microsoft Outlook, Mozilla Thunderbird, and Apple Mail.
